What Exactly Is the Mind-Muscle Connection?
At its core, the mind-muscle connection is a form of internal attentional focus. Instead of focusing externally on simply moving a weight from point A to point B, you direct your full concentration inward, onto the sensation of the target muscle doing the work.
This isn’t just fitness jargon or “bro-science”; it’s a tangible neuromuscular phenomenon. Every movement you make begins as a signal in your brain. This electrical impulse travels down your spinal cord and through motor neurons to the muscle fibers, instructing them to contract. This meeting point between nerve and muscle is called the neuromuscular junction.
When you actively think about squeezing a specific muscle, you enhance the quality and magnitude of that electrical signal. You are essentially turning up the neurological drive to that particular muscle, recruiting more of its individual muscle fibers and motor units. A motor unit consists of a single motor neuron and all the muscle fibers it innervates.
Think of it like a conductor leading an orchestra. A novice conductor might just wave the baton to get a general sound, but a master conductor can cue the violin section to swell with precision, creating a richer, more targeted musical phrase. Similarly, a strong mind-muscle connection allows you to “conduct” your muscles with greater accuracy, ensuring the intended muscle group performs the bulk of the work.
The Science Behind the Squeeze: Why It Matters
The benefits of developing a strong mind-muscle connection are not just anecdotal; they are supported by a growing body of scientific research. Studies using electromyography (EMG), a technique that measures the electrical activity produced by muscles, have repeatedly shown that an internal focus can significantly increase muscle activation.
Enhanced Muscle Growth (Hypertrophy)
One of the primary drivers of muscle growth is mechanical tension—the force placed on muscle fibers as they are stretched and contracted under load. When you use your mind-muscle connection to better activate a target muscle, you place more of that tension directly where you want it.
Leading hypertrophy researcher Dr. Brad Schoenfeld and his colleagues have published studies demonstrating this effect. In one notable experiment, participants performing bench presses and bicep curls with an internal focus on the chest or biceps showed significantly greater muscle growth in those areas compared to a group that just focused on lifting the weight.
By ensuring the target muscle is the prime mover, you maximize the growth-signaling stimulus it receives from each and every repetition. This means you get more hypertrophic benefit from the same amount of weight and reps.
Improved Strength and Performance
A stronger mind-muscle connection also translates to better strength gains. When your brain becomes more efficient at recruiting a specific muscle, your movement patterns become cleaner and more powerful. You learn to initiate movements with the correct muscles instead of relying on momentum or secondary, compensatory muscles.
For example, many people struggle to feel their latissimus dorsi (“lats”) working during rows or pull-downs, often allowing their biceps and upper back to take over. By developing an MMC with their lats, they can learn to pull with their back first, leading to a stronger and more effective pull.
Injury Prevention
This improved motor control is also crucial for safety. When you are acutely aware of how a muscle feels during an exercise, you are also more attuned to signs of improper form or excessive strain. A strong MMC helps you keep the tension on the muscle and off of vulnerable joints, tendons, and ligaments.
If you’re squatting and consciously focusing on engaging your glutes and quads, you are less likely to let your lower back round or your knees cave inward—two common faults that can lead to injury. This mindful approach ensures the load is borne by the structures best equipped to handle it.
From Mind to Muscle: Practical Strategies for a Stronger Connection
The mind-muscle connection is a skill, and like any skill, it requires deliberate practice. Here are several actionable strategies you can implement in your next workout to start building a more powerful connection.
1. Lighten the Load
Ego is the enemy of the mind-muscle connection. When you lift a weight that is too heavy, your body enters survival mode. Its only goal is to move the load, and it will recruit any and every muscle it can to get the job done. This shifts your focus from internal (feeling the muscle) to external (moving the weight).
Reduce the weight to something you can comfortably control, perhaps 50-60% of your typical working weight. This allows you to stop worrying about failure and start focusing on the quality of each contraction.
2. Slow Down the Tempo
Rushing through reps is another way to kill the connection. Instead, control every phase of the lift. A good starting point is a 2-1-3 tempo: take two seconds for the concentric (lifting) phase, pause for one second at the peak contraction, and take a full three seconds for the eccentric (lowering) phase.
The eccentric portion is particularly important, as it’s where a significant amount of muscle damage (a component of growth) occurs. Controlling the negative forces you to stay engaged with the muscle throughout the entire range of motion.
3. Incorporate Pauses and Squeezes
That one-second pause at the top of the movement is your golden opportunity to reinforce the connection. At the point of peak contraction—like the top of a bicep curl or when your shoulder blades are retracted in a row—consciously and forcefully squeeze the target muscle for a full second before beginning the negative.
This isometric hold floods the muscle with neurological feedback, teaching your brain exactly what it feels like for that muscle to be fully engaged.
4. Use Tactile Cues (Touch)
Your sense of touch can be a powerful learning tool. When appropriate and possible, physically touch the muscle you are trying to work. For instance, you can place your free hand on your quad during a leg extension or tap the side of your delt during a lateral raise.
This physical feedback provides a direct target for your brain, reinforcing the mental cue and making it easier to direct your focus to the right spot.
5. Visualize the Muscle Working
Before and during your set, create a clear mental image of the muscle you are targeting. Picture its location in your body, see the fibers shortening as you lift the weight, and visualize them lengthening as you lower it. Imagine the muscle contracting and pulling on the bone to create the movement. This visualization practice can significantly enhance your ability to activate it.
6. Start with Isolation Exercises
It is far easier to establish a mind-muscle connection with a single muscle during an isolation (single-joint) exercise than during a compound (multi-joint) lift. Exercises like bicep curls, tricep pushdowns, leg extensions, and lateral raises are perfect for this practice.
Once you master the feeling on these simpler movements, you can then transfer that heightened awareness to more complex lifts like squats, deadlifts, and bench presses, focusing on the role of specific muscles within the larger movement pattern.
